Conclusion

The Samsung E700 is a fun phone for those who loves technology. With the built in camera, it allows one to take interesting photos and add nice addons to it before sending it via MMS. As you can see from the photos taken, the VGA (640x480) mode is still reasonably clear but still not comparable to the real digital cameras. Comparing that with lower resolution pictures, the lower resolution 15 shots photo are pretty good quality.

While we were playing with the E700, we noticed that the 40 channels polyphonic ringtone is softer than the current V200 and S300 phones. This can be a problem if you are in a noisy environment. If you are into MMF files, you can use PSMplayer to compensate the volume level by making the MMF file louder.

In terms of built, the E700 is sturdy and the looks is better than the S300 or V200. One thing that I noticed is that the OLED / LCD is clear and colours very vibrant under normal lighting conditions. The only drawback is that it will appear dim under strong sunlight especially in tropical countries making it difficult to read the contents on the screen.

In terms of features, this phone is a Dual Band phone which restricts it to only European and Asian customers. The E700 supports JAVA and MMS. There is also IRDA for transferring of files using software available on the samsungmobile.com.sg website. Something missing is the data cable which should have been bundled within the package.
